技术特征:

1.一种基于html5canvas画布音视频分段剪辑方法,其特征在于:包括如下步骤:

步骤一:首先使用者预先获取源音视频文件,然后使用者对音视频文件分段剪辑时,进入音视频文件分段剪辑主单元,然后再根据表现种类不同,将整段音视频文件分成视频部分分段剪辑和音频部分分段剪辑两个子单元;

步骤二:接着使用者做好剪辑预先技巧准备工作,将整段视频以秒为单位进行分段剪辑,且至少分为30段,且分段的视频片段分别标记为d1、d2、d3.......d30,且将30段视频片段按照顺序排列,然后再根据分段时间线对每段视频的分段时间节点进行系统构建,待视频分段时间线构建完成后,接着使用者再以秒为单位确定每个分段中的镜头长度;

步骤三:待视频部分分段剪辑完成后,使用者再将音视频文件中的音频部分以帧为单位进行分段,同样至少分为30段,且分段的音频片段分别标记为y1、y2、y3.......y30,然后使用者再通过音频剪辑模块对每段音频进行剪辑;

步骤四:待视频部分和音频部分分段剪辑完成后,使用者再将剪辑的各个视频和音频片段进行文件组合生成,形成初步音视频剪辑文件,接着使用者再由音视频文件回看单元对剪辑完成的音视频进行回看;

步骤五:且使用者对剪辑完成的音视频回看后,音视频画面和音频经过放大模块进行信号帧数放大处理后传输至滤波模块,且滤波模块对音视频文件中的背景噪音杂波和自身噪音杂波进行滤除后,再将处理完成的音视频剪辑文件以链接分享的方式发送至试看播放界面,然后使用者再次打开音视频剪辑文件进行多次试看,且次数至少为3次,待音视频剪辑文件合格后,即可进行正片播放,若音视频剪辑文件试看存在问题,则重新进入音视频文件分段剪辑单元进行返工修改,直至音视频剪辑文件效果达到满意为止,再进入正片播放。

2.根据权利要求1所述的一种基于html5canvas画布音视频分段剪辑方法,其特征在于:所述在步骤二过程中,剪辑预先技巧准备包括确认思想主线、节奏点注重把握、体现视频画面张力、视频表现整体连贯感以及注重转场剪辑技巧。

3.根据权利要求2所述的一种基于html5canvas画布音视频分段剪辑方法,其特征在于:所述确认思想主线:使用者观看视频时,根据剧情清楚了解贯穿视频的一条中心主线以及中心思想所在,根据剧情思想进行视频画面分段处理,节奏点注重把握:对视频剧情和音乐所处重合点进行斟酌,凸出视频画面本身的内容、情节、人物表情和动作,体现视频画面张力:由于被拍摄主体和背景在画面中呈现的特点范围,会传递转达一种具体含义的画面语音,使用者重点抓住此点进行画面凸显即可,视频表现整体连贯感:使用者根据视频剧情发展、故事情节进行连贯性思考,完善视频剧情的完整路线走向,注重转场剪辑技巧:常用技术转场手段主要有三种,分别为叠化、定格以及淡出淡入,且叠化为上下镜头交叠,前一个镜头逐渐浅淡的同时,后一个画面逐渐清晰;定格为将前一个镜头做定格起到突出强调的作用,再出现后一镜头,淡出淡入为一个画面的清晰度和色饱和度逐渐淡下去,直至成为白场或者黑场,下一个画面的清晰度和色饱和度逐渐淡上来。

4.根据权利要求1所述的一种基于html5canvas画布音视频分段剪辑方法,其特征在于:所述在步骤二过程中,分段时间线构建时,使用者预先导入已有的时间线文件,读取方法是从根元素开始,利用递归进行深度优先遍历,再将xml中的时间线信息加入树中,再利用树形结构显示和修改时间线,实现添加、删除组、轨迹、剪辑,及修改组和剪辑属性的功能,并构造树节点类,然后使用者再将树节点输出树形结构为xml文档,再将编辑好的xml文档构建成时间线对象,以供预览或输出视频文件,直接利用des开发工具中的分析器进行转化,最后再由智能搜索引擎显示完成。

5.根据权利要求1所述的一种基于html5canvas画布音视频分段剪辑方法,其特征在于:所述在步骤二过程中,剪辑镜头长度确定包括根据视频内容风格因素、根据视频内容节奏和根据观众观看需求。

6.根据权利要求5所述的一种基于html5canvas画布音视频分段剪辑方法,其特征在于:所述根据视频内容风格因素:使用者再进行分段剪辑前,先对视频内容风格进行研究以把握剪辑后作品的最终风格,再判断画面剪辑镜头的长度,对于视频的风格,常用蒙太奇的手法来调节原始镜头,而另一种长镜头的表现手法为力求表现最原始的画面,根据视频内容节奏:节奏是表达视频风格的一种主要形式,长镜头尽量让画面的时间贴近现实时间,短镜头则利用紧凑的画面变换来加快节奏,展现出紧张刺激的感观,根据观众观看需求:根据观众的实际需求和喜好,将重要内容剪入视频中,在进入下一个镜头后,保证观众有足够的时间看清画面内容和情节,静态的主体容易在短时间被观众看清,即选用短镜头,而动态的主体根据其运动的速度来调节镜头长度,让观众再合理的时间内观看视频内容。

7.根据权利要求1所述的一种基于html5canvas画布音视频分段剪辑方法,其特征在于:所述在步骤三过程中,音频剪辑模块包括同场景声音环境切换技巧和不同场景之间变换时声音的切换两种方式。

8.根据权利要求7所述的一种基于html5canvas画布音视频分段剪辑方法,其特征在于:所述同场景声音环境切换技巧:声音剪辑要遵循无痕处理,让观众的注意力都集中在视觉感官上,不同场景之间变换时声音的切换:在场景转换变化时,声音也要相应转换,给观众提供逻辑性观赏体验。

html5音频剪辑,一种基于HTML5Canvas画布音视频分段剪辑方法与流程相关推荐

  1. html5填空题阅卷,一种基于图像识别的填空题自动阅卷方法与流程

    本发明涉及自动阅卷技术领域,尤其涉及一种基于图像识别的填空题自动阅卷方法. 背景技术: 随着电子信息的发达,越来越多的工作被计算机取代,例如,自动阅卷已经逐渐取代人工阅卷. 现有的自动阅卷系统,更多的 ...

  2. arcgis android gif,一种基于动态地图符号的移动GIS可视化方法与流程

    本发明具体涉及一种基于动态地图符号的移动GIS可视化方法动态地图符号的技术领域 背景技术: 随着移动设备的高度集成化和处理器的快速发展,终端设备的计算和处理能力不断增强,移动GIS的应用领域越来越广泛 ...

  3. oracle自动售票服务器,一种基于Oracle数据库客户端的业务自动处理方法与流程

    技术领域 本发明涉及计算机技术领域,具体地说是一种实用性强.基于Oracle数据库客户端的业务自动处理方法. 背景技术: 在实现预约挂号的移动应用中,由于医院业务系统处理缺失自动取消预约功能,经常需要 ...

  4. linux ipmitool检测内存,一种基于ipmitool工具循环侦测内存的方法与流程

    本发明涉及服务器技术领域,具体的说是一种基于ipmitool工具循环侦测内存的方法. 背景技术: 随着计算机技术的发展,计算机已经广泛应用于生活.工作中各个领域,对计算机计算处理能力和存储能力也提出了 ...

  5. aes子密钥生成c语言_一种基于流密码算法的子密钥生成方法与流程

    本发明涉及一种用于分组加解密算法的子密钥的生成方法. 背景技术: 随着信息技术的发展,信息安全性的问题却愈来愈显得突出,保证信息安全的一个重要技术就是密码学.密码学在信息安全技术中扮演着基础的角色,是 ...

  6. sar图像去噪matlab,一种基于总曲率的SAR图像变分去噪方法与流程

    本发明属于数字图像处理技术领域,具体涉及一种基于总曲率的SAR图像变分去噪方法. 背景技术: : 相干斑噪声是合成孔径雷达(Synthetic Aperture Radar,简称SAR)图像的重要特征 ...

  7. 电容屏物体识别_一种基于触摸屏触摸点的物体识别方法与流程

    本发明涉及触摸屏触摸点物体识别技术领域,具体为一种基于触摸屏触摸点的物体识别方法. 背景技术: 多触点触摸屏支持多个触点同时输入,通过触摸屏的点的特征,进行物体识别是一个成熟的技术,以下简称物体识别为 ...

  8. 企业微信推送消息延迟_一种基于企业微信的消息推送方法与流程

    本发明涉及消息推送技术领域,特别涉及一种基于企业微信的消息推送方法. 背景技术: 随着微信公众号的普及,微信企业号也越来越受到人们的关注.而腾讯公司在微信企业号的基础上又进行了进一步的升级,提供了类似 ...

  9. 机器人测钢卷直径_一种基于关节机器人的冷轧钢卷卷芯焊接方法与流程

    本发明涉及冶金技术领域,特别涉及一种基于关节机器人的冷轧钢卷卷芯焊接方法. 背景技术: 在冷轧罩式退火工序,钢卷采用立式吊具吊运,为防止钢卷卷芯松动导致卷芯钢带损坏和抽芯故障,必须将钢卷卷芯内圈焊接固 ...

最新文章

  1. 常见NoSQL系统使用场景分析
  2. 报名即将截止,中国移动“梧桐杯”大数据应用创新大赛,寻找大数据敢想者!...
  3. PHP MySQL教程期末考试题及答案,PHPMySQL答案
  4. 1.12 总结-深度学习第四课《卷积神经网络》-Stanford吴恩达教授
  5. OpenCV形态学变换函数morphologyEx()顶帽运算的使用
  6. C# 静态类和非静态类(实例类)
  7. poj 1734 (最小环)
  8. Memcached学习---(3)Windows 下安装 Memcached
  9. 云单元架构,如何赋能数字化转型呢?
  10. petshop4.0 详解之五(PetShop之业务逻辑层设计)(转帖)
  11. 90后IT男被准丈母娘拒绝:家境不重要,重要的是…戳中痛处
  12. CentOS 挂载数据盘
  13. Windows下SVNServer安装和配置
  14. java sqlldr_sqlldr详解
  15. “拼多多”的假面人生
  16. 现行高考政策公平 辩论_辩论文:现行高考模式有(不)利于选拔入才
  17. 手机显示DNS服务器异常,手机dns服务器异常怎么设置
  18. 【原创】2009.6.22犀浦记
  19. Warning_The `android.dexOptions.incremental` property is deprecated and it has no effect on the buil
  20. Fedora进行ffmpeg+nginx+rtmp服务器配置局域网推流

热门文章

  1. Vue将当前页面转为PDF并下载
  2. 搜索结构之K模型与KV模型
  3. 评测三款最流行的mobi阅读器(Mac适用)
  4. 【无为则无心Python基础】— 19、Python中的输入
  5. Microsoft Excel 套用表格格式
  6. html的pp标记的作用,HTML学习笔记 · sonnypp
  7. [pytorch]计算图:对神经网络的图式描述:自动求导的数学基础
  8. java中的隔空字符_中国“最大恒星级黑洞”研究遭质疑!Nature上演隔空对话,它究竟有多大?...
  9. data-属性的作用
  10. 计算机主版维修与数据恢复报告,全国计算机检测维修与数据恢复主板及功能板检测与维修策略...